In the most recent year for which we have data, Santa Clara University conferred 362 bachelor’s degrees in business, management & marketing.
SCU is in the top 5% of the country for business, management & marketing at the bachelor’s level. Specifically, it ranked #4 out of 84 schools by College Factual.
Business, Management & Marketing graduates with a bachelor’s degree from SCU go on to jobs where they make a median salary of $119,853 a year. This is higher than $110,779, the median for all majors at SCU.
To complete a bachelor’s at SCU, business, management & marketing students accumulate a median of $17,700 in student loans. This is below $20,351, the typical median for all majors at SCU.

For the most recent academic year available, 65% of business, management & marketing bachelor’s degrees went to men and 35% went to women.
The largest share of business, management & marketing bachelor’s degree graduates at SCU are White. Approximately 44% of graduates fell into this category.
The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from Santa Clara University with a bachelor’s in business, management & marketing.
| Ethnic Background | Number of Students |
|---|---|
| Asian | 73 |
| Black or African American | 6 |
| Hispanic or Latino | 56 |
| White | 161 |
| Non-Resident Aliens | 24 |
| Other Races | 42 |
